Roxel is an Anglo‑French company that designs, develops and manufactures solid propellant rocket motors for use in tactical missiles. It operates across several sites in the UK and France with an annual turnover of about £200M and nearly 1,000 staff.

Role and responsibilities
Laboratory Scientists play an important role in manufacturing processes by testing a wide variety of explosive and non‑explosive samples to ensure they meet standards and specifications. The laboratory team operates across four laboratories, each specialising in different testing disciplines, with opportunities to develop competency in multiple areas.
The successful candidate will work as part of the laboratory team, carrying out the preparation and testing of a wide range of raw materials, intermediate production materials and final products. Some materials are explosive in nature.
There are a wide variety of testing techniques used, including:
* Chemical analyses using techniques such as HPLC, GC, FTIR, AAS, and traditional gravimetric and volumetric methods
* Physical and thermal testing such as tensile testing, differential scanning calorimetry (DSC) and dynamic mechanical thermal analysis (DMTA)
* Other techniques specific to the industry, with training provided as required
There are opportunities to work in several laboratories and to develop competency in a wide range of testing techniques, ensuring there is always something new to learn.
